PRE-EXPRESSIVITY & SCENIC PRESENCE

A Goossun Art-illery workshop in collaboration with Moven’act


Goossun Art-illery offers a four day workshop for performers (actors and dancers). The workshop is an introduction to Goossun Art-illery’s way of training performers, which is a result of Vahid’s study of the work of the twentieth century’s theatre reformers such as Stanislavski, Graig, Grotowski and Odin Teatret. It is both the technical aspect of the craft as well as the artistic and cultural vision of these reformers that link the heritage of these masters in Goossun Art-illery´s work. Vahid has studied their work for more than a decade through whatever possible means: books, photographs, films and through participation in and observation of the work of their pupils.


That in combination with Vahid’s direct and personal study with different teachers and prominent theatre practitioners such as Eugenio Barba, Augusto Boal, Akira Matsui, Augusto Omolú, as well as Vahid’s own personal research in Iran have motivated a certain need to search for a special way of training that focuses on developing individual technical solutions uniquely for each performer without trying to impose one homogenizing methodical approach to the craft of the performer.

Goossun Art-illery practices theatre research internationally, in Denmark, the UK and beyond. This workshop is part of a series of workshops run by Goossun Art-illery during the spring and summer of 2009 as preparation for HamletZar. HamletZar is a research project and performance, based on Shakespeare’s Hamlet and the Middle Eastern possession cult Zar. The project is being developed over a total of eight residencies that will take place in Denmark, England, Scotland, Canada and the Middle East. Beginning in June 2009 the project will culminate in a performance production over 18 months, which will tour internationally.
